Advantages of Joining a Weight Loss Clinic



If you're looking to slim down and stay motivated, joining a weight loss clinic can use you many advantages. Among the major benefits is the support and guidance you get from experts who specialize in fat burning. They can create a personalized plan tailored to your specific needs and objectives, aiding you make healthier food selections and create a workout regimen that works for you.

Furthermore, belonging to a weight loss clinic supplies a sense of community and responsibility. You can connect with others who get on the exact same journey as you, sharing experiences, obstacles, and success. This support group can maintain you inspired and influenced, particularly during tough times.

Furthermore, weight loss clinics usually use educational sources, workshops, and seminars to aid you gain knowledge about proper nourishment, part control, and sustainable way of living changes.

Factors to consider Prior To Signing Up With a Weight Loss Clinic



Before deciding, you must thoroughly consider the benefits and disadvantages of joining a weight loss clinic. Right here are some key considerations to bear in mind:

- ** Cost **: Weight loss clinics can be expensive, so it is essential to assess whether the potential advantages exceed the financial investment.

- ** Program Framework **: Different facilities provide varying program frameworks, so it's important to locate one that aligns with your goals and preferences. Think about variables such as the frequency of appointments, the schedule of personalized meal strategies, and the level of assistance supplied.

- ** Long-Term Dedication **: Weight loss is a journey that calls for long-lasting commitment and way of life modifications. Prior to joining a center, ask on your own if you're ready to make the required modifications and sustain them over time.

- ** Success Rate **: Study the success rate of the center and its previous customers. Look for testimonials and evaluations to evaluate the performance of the program.
